Petroleum refining industry is crude oil to be processed as by petroleum refining process the industry of various oil products, including oil
Refinery, the research of petroleum refining and design organization etc., the main production plant in petroleum refinery generally has:Crude distillation(Often, subtract
Pressure distillation), thermal cracking, catalytic cracking, be hydrocracked, petroleum coking, catalytic reforming and refinery gas processing, refining of petroleum products
Deng mainly producing gasoline, jet fuel, kerosene, diesel oil, fuel oil, lubricating oil, pertroleum wax, asphalt, petroleum coke and various
Petrochemical materials.
The broad understanding of reactor has the container physically or chemically reacted, is matched somebody with somebody by the structure design to container with parameter
Put, realize the mixture function of the heating of technological requirement, evaporation, cooling and low high speed.

Operation principle:When people need to refine oil, crude oil and catalyst are poured into reactor, start driving dress
To put, upper strata raw material is stirred, first rotating shaft drives the second rotating shaft to turn, and turning drive agitating device by the second rotating shaft works,
Lower floor's raw material is stirred, when people need not stir, closes drive device, opens valve, crude oil after stirring from
Discharge nozzle flows out.
Because drive device includes motor, first bearing seat, first rotating shaft, fixed plate, first bevel gear, transverse slat and erected
Straight agitating plate, reactor top are provided with motor, and the output shaft of motor is provided with first rotating shaft, and first rotating shaft is passed through at the top of reactor,
Reactor inner top is provided with first bearing seat, and first rotating shaft passes through first bearing seat, fixed plate is provided among first rotating shaft, fixed
It is fixed at left and right sides of plate on reactor inwall, lower section is provided with first bevel gear in first rotating shaft, and first bevel gear is positioned at fixation
Below plate, first rotating shaft bottom is provided with transverse slat, and the vertical agitating plate of symmetrical expression is provided with left and right sides of transverse slat.So when people start electricity
During machine, motor driven first rotating shaft turns, and drives first bevel gear to rotate therewith, and first rotating shaft turns band motion plate and vertical agitating plate
Rotation, is stirred to top raw material.
Because agitating device includes second bearing seat, small pulley, the second rotating shaft, second bevel gear, belt, 3rd bearing
Seat, big belt wheel, the 3rd rotating shaft and stirring vane, reactor inside upper left side are provided with second bearing seat, and second bearing seat is provided with
Second rotating shaft, the second rotating shaft reach outside through reactor inwall, and the second rotating shaft left end is provided with small pulley, the second rotating shaft right side
Provided with second bevel gear, second bevel gear engages with first bevel gear, and lower left side is provided with 3rd bearing seat inside reactor, and the 3rd
Bearing block is provided with the 3rd rotating shaft, and the 3rd rotating shaft reaches outside through reactor inwall, and the 3rd rotating shaft left end is provided with big belt wheel,
Belt is connected between big belt wheel and small pulley, the 3rd rotating shaft is provided with stirring vane.So first rotating shaft, which rotates, drives first
Bevel gear rotates, and first bevel gear engages with second bevel gear, and first rotating shaft drives the second axis of rotation, and two axis of rotation drive
Small pulley is rotated, and small pulley is rotated by belt drive big belt wheel, and big belt wheel, which rotates, drives the 3rd axis of rotation, stirring vane
Concomitant rotation, the raw material of reactor bottom is stirred.
